2G TSX Key Fob Alternative?
I was looking at replacing one of the switchblade type of key fobs with a Honda style key found online. It looks slightly less bulky with less moving parts to fail. Has anyone tried this? Looking at the photos it looks like there is a spot for the transponder chip and I haven't found anything yet to make me think this wouldn't work.

The immobilizer transponder chip should be included with the key and will need to be programmed into your ECU. A good automotive locksmith and program it for you. The correct FOB electronics is important and must match the TSX operation. I needed a second FOB and after several aftermarket FOBs would not sync as "Driver 1", the locksmith procured an OEM FOB. There is a difference in the electronics for the Driver 1 and Driver 2 FOBs, so if a different Honda FOB works, you might lose the ability to sync the driver settings with the FOB.
Visit a local automotive locksmith and they may be able to offer you an alternative to the switchblade FOB. |
